2001 CLK 320 starting issue

I have a CLK 320.Sometimes when I insert the key and turn to start,nothing happens. There is power to the dash,but not even a starter click. I remove the key and try again,starts right up.Tried my spare key and the same thing happens.I thought maybe the battery in the key was bad. I also just installed a new starting battery.No luck.Any thoughts?

I can start by saying that the battery in the key has no effect on starting the car, they battery is only for the remote functions.
